Multicentric chondrosarcoma involving the appendicular skeleton: a case report and literature review.

V Aran1, W Meohas2, A C de Sá Lopes2, L Maciel Cabral3, A Fortuna-Costa1, J A Matheus Guimarães1, M E Leite Duarte1.   

Abstract

Chondrosarcomas constitute the 3rd most common primary bone malignancy. These tumours grow slowly and rarely metastasize, usually having a good prognosis after surgery. Among patients registered and treated at the Brazilian National Institute of Traumatology and Orthopedics, an uncommon case of chondrosarcoma was identified in a 63-year-old man, who was diagnosed with multicentric chondrosarcoma of the appendicular skeleton. This example is atypical in the medical literature because multicentric tumours are different from metastatic events, and their frequency in chondrosarcoma is rare. This article therefore provides a rare case report alongside a review of additional cases in the medical literature. 2020 Multimed Inc.
